What is the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?

Roll off and front load dumpsters have features which make them useful for various kinds of occupations.

A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They generally have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.

A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a useful alternative for businesses that accumulate considerable amounts of garbage.

While roll off dumpsters are generally left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. That makes it feasible for sterilization professionals to eliminate garbage and trash for multiple homes and businesses in the area at affordable prices.


Some Things You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ster

Although the particular rules that control what you can and cannot contain in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of materials that most dumpster rental service in North Stoningtons WOn't let. A number of the things that you typically cannot put in the dumpster contain:

Batteries, especially the kind that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other substances that may harm the environment) Electronics, especially those that comprise batteries There are likewise some mattresses you could usually put in your dumpster so long as you're will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ental company to get a list of things that you just can't put into the dumpster.

Trash removal vs dumpster rental in North Stonington - Which is good for you?

If you have a job you are about to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your rubbish and rubbish for you, or if you should just rent a dumpster in North Stonington and load it yourself.

Renting a container is a better alternative if you prefer the flexibility to load it on your own time and you do not mind doing it yourself to save on labor. Dumpsters also function well in the event that you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s typically begin at 10 cubic yards, so should you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for a lot more dumpster than you need.

Trash or rubbish removal makes more sense should you prefer another person to load your old stuff. Additionally, it works well should you prefer it to be taken away quickly so it is out of your hair, or in the event that you simply have a few large items; this is likely c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Bag

Dumpster totes may offer an option to roll of dumpsters. Whether this alternative works well for you, though, will depend on your job.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al alternative that works for you.

Roll Off Dumpsters

It's difficult to overcome a roll off dumpster when you have a sizable undertaking that'll create lots of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, in order to av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ters typically have time restrictions because firms need to get them back for other customers. This really is a potential drawback if you aren't good at meeting deadlines.

Dumpster Bags

Dumpster totes are often suitable for small jobs with loose deadlines. In the event you do not need a lot of room for debris, then the bags could function well for you. Many businesses are also pleased to let you keep the totes for as long as you want. That makes them useful for longer jobs.


How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, as long as you don't load it higher compared to the sides of the container. Over-fil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are simply not safe, and firms will not carry unsafe loads in order to safeguard motorists and passengers on the road.

In certain regions,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. In case your load is too high, it WOn't be able to be tarped so you may have to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might result in extra charges if it requires you to keep the dumpster for a longer period of time. Remember to maintain your load no higher compared to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be good.

Dumpster rental guidelines

When you want to rent a dumpster in North Stonington to use at your house, it's a great id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, determine the size dumpster which will work best for your project. Temporary dumpsters usually come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Then think about the positioning of the dumpster on your premises. Recommendations call for you to give a place that's double the width and height of the container. This will ensure proper height and space clearance.

The price you are quoted for the container will include a one time delivery and pick-up fee, together with standard f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You ought to also realize that you can only f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, it's also wise to check to your local city or municipality to determine whether a permit is necessary to put the container on the street.


Choosing the top dumpster for your project size

Picking the top dumpster for your project is an important aspect of dumpster rental in North Stonington. If you decide on a dumpster that's too little, you will not have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you'll have to schedule additional excursions. In case you choose one that's too huge, you'll save time, but you'll waste money.

If you call a dumpster rental company in North Stonington and describe the job for which you desire a dumpster, they can urge the finest size. Their years of experience mean they often get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ster generally works well for medium-sized cleanup projects and small rem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best option for large dwelling cleanup projects and medium-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are perfect for a house cleanout or remodeling jobs on a large house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ively large and are used just on the biggest projects like new construction.
